You can create up to four Groups for the current mix. The Group configurations as well as their volume and
mute status are saved as part of a Mix Preset.
When a Group is selected while mixing on the A360, the Reverb, Tone, and Stereo Placement controls are
disabled. These settings can only be changed when in the Group edit mode. See the explanation that
follows.

Edit a Group

Once a Group has been defined, the individual channel components of the Group can still be edited.
To make changes to a Group:
1.
Select one of the of four defined Groups to be edited by pressing any channel button that
is included in the Group. The Group button's LED should be lit solid.
